A section of a ceiling in The Dubai Mall that collapsed on Monday, September 7, has been repaired, confirmed developer Emaar Properties.

The Dubai Media Office posted pictures of the now-repaired ceiling on Twitter on Tuesday.

The official statement said: "Emaar Properties has announced it has repaired the damage to a suspended ceiling in one of the corridors in Dubai Mall, which caused part of it to fall late Monday. The repair works have been completed without any injuries."
